The mangrove swamp is a wetland Minecraft:biome populated with Minecraft:mud and Minecraft:mangroves where Minecraft:slimes, Minecraft:frogs, and Minecraft:bogged can spawn.

Generation

Mangrove swamp biomes are usually found in flat terrain near sea level in regions with very high erosion values, and they also replace Minecraft:rivers in these areas. Mangrove swamps never directly border the Minecraft:ocean, but their water bodies are often connected.

They generate replacing Minecraft:swamps in higher temperature zones, next to Minecraft:savannas, all Minecraft:jungles, and Minecraft:deserts, and less commonly Minecraft:forests and Minecraft:plains. Mangrove swamps are often surrounded by Minecraft:windswept savanna ranges. Within the biome, some higher patches of temperate land biomes may generate, allowing Minecraft:villages to touch them.

Description

Mangrove swamp biomes are a variant of the Minecraft:swamp biome featuring dense Minecraft:mangrove trees which vary in height and sometimes contain a bee nest with Minecraft:bees. The floor is mainly composed of Minecraft:mud blocks with occasional grass block or dirt Minecraft:disks. Minecraft:Seagrass litters the bottom of flooded areas, and Minecraft:lily pads dot the water's surface.

Template:IN, unlike most Overworld biomes, Minecraft:mushrooms do not generate here. The grass has the same color as the normal swamp, determined by a Minecraft:temperature gradient, but leaves and vines have a unique light green tint, and the water is teal rather than gray. Warm Minecraft:frogs and Minecraft:tropical fish are the only passive mobs that spawn in this biome.

Additional Minecraft:slimes may spawn in mangrove swamps during the night, exclusively between Y=50 and Y=70. Their spawn rate is affected by the Minecraft:moon phase, spawning most often during full moon and not spawning at all during new moon. Minecraft:Bogged add an additional threat to the night, thunderstorms, or caves.Template:Only

Mangrove swamp biomes, alongside Minecraft:deserts and regular swamps, can generate Minecraft:fossils underground. However, Minecraft:swamp huts do not generate here.

Minecraft:Villagers that spawn in mangrove swamps get a unique swamp-themed look. While villages don't generate in swamps, they are commonly found bordering one with some houses in the biome. Otherwise, swamp villagers can only spawn by curing Minecraft:zombie villagers in this biome or breeding villagers here.

Underwater Minecraft:fog is thick here, making visibility lower underwater. With Minecraft:Vibrant Visuals, mangrove swamps use a strong humid volumetric fog setting similar to Minecraft:jungles, which fades the distance in an orange tint, and moonlight is colored more vibrant blue. Mangrove swamps have brighter blue daytime sky colors, and a slightly warmer color grading, but not as much as jungles.
